1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Nitrogenous bases are joined by which type of bond? Options: polar bonds, ionic bonds, covalent bonds, hydrogen bonds
Back
hydrogen bonds
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
DNA codes for...
Back
proteins
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which process is shown? Options: diffusion, respiration, recombination, translation
Back
translation
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Blueprint for the production of RNA within a cell? Options: DNA, protein, ATO, carbohydrate
Back
DNA
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What molecules do both DNA and RNA contain? Options: uracil, nucleotides, thymine, deoxyribose
Back
nucleotides
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
DNA sequence is ACAGTG. How would this be coded on mRNA? Options: TGTCAC, UGUCAC, GUGACA, CACUGU
Back
UGUCAC
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Genetic info flows in one direction. Which best represents the CENTRAL DOGMA? Options: DNA-protein-RNA, Protein-RNA-DNA, RNA-protein-DNA, DNA-RNA-protein
Back
DNA-RNA-protein
